Poster greatly enjoyed his music and style and Roch Parisien, All Music Guide provided a review of the album where this was Track 1: "Mothers of Hope offers more substance than most in this vein. James' cool, casual party vibes are mixed with Gospel choir segues and lyrics that go far beyond hackneyed mating rituals. James has assembled a large ensemble of veteran Canadian players for Mothers of Hope, including the leading lights of such former domestic soul-pop hitmakers as Motherlode and Dr. Music. The cast smolders nicely. The title track sets the album's upbeat theme -- that each of us is responsible for passing on the good in life to generations that come. Without getting preachy, the disc works up a potent instrumental and lyrical ecstacy that is rather captivating."
